ECONOMY NEWS
- ➤ The Colorado Department of Transportation released the 2025 Colorado Aviation Economic Impact Study showing that Colorado Springs Airport generated $5.2 billion in business revenue in 2023—a 53 percent increase from the 2020 report based on 2018 revenue. The study also found that total jobs grew from 25,093 to 34,829 and payroll rose from $1.5 billion to $2.7 billion, underscoring the airport's key role in local economic growth. EDUCATION NEWS
- ➤ Academy D-20 board president Aaron Salt resigned at a special meeting Tuesday night and his resignation will take effect on June 1 (he began work as Woodland Park RE-2 interim superintendent earlier this month after Ken Witt resigned); the board also named Amy Shandy as its new president and Derrick Wilburn as treasurer while it begins to search for a temporary member to fill his seat until the November election. G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 Colorado Springs Utilities proposed a 2.4% natural gas rate increase starting April 1 that will raise the average residential bill by about $6.47—pending a City Council vote on March 25. The move comes as increased national gas prices and export demand drive up costs. Colorado Springs Gazette
- ➤ Starting Monday, March 24, northbound Tejon Street from Colorado Avenue to Pikes Peak Avenue will be closed for the Tejon Street Revitalization Project — street parking is suspended and temporary pedestrian walkways are set up while southbound traffic remains open. Crews will remove trees on March 25 and continue work in Block 1 through late June — construction then shifts to Block 2, with local businesses offering limited parking vouchers. REAL ESTATE NEWS
- ➤ Toll Brothers announced Foxtail Crossing—a gated community near the intersection of Tutt and Dublin Blvd in northeast Colorado Springs, where construction of the sales center and model homes is underway and sales will start in early summer. The community will offer luxury single-family living with flexible floor plans and personalization options with homes expected to be priced from the $500,000s. Colorado Springs Business Journal
